About Iestyn Williams
Iestyn Williams is a scholar working on General Health Professions, Economics and Econometrics, Education,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management and Nephrology, having authored 95 papers that have together received 2.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(28 papers), Healthcare cost, quality, practices (22 papers), Healthcare Policy and Management (15 papers), Healthcare innovation and challenges (12 papers), Primary Care and Health Outcomes (6 papers), Dialysis and Renal Disease Management (6 papers), Global Health Care Issues (6 papers) and Health Services Management and Policy (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Public Administration (116 citations), General Health Professions (553 citations), Economics and Econometrics (528 citations), Civil and Structural Engineering (295 citations) and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management (103 citations). Iestyn Williams has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Stirling Bryan, Suzanne Robinson, Heather Shearer, Helen Dickinson, Shirley McIver, A. Minjigmaa, Arie van Riessen, Melissa Lee, William D.A. Rickard and Jadambaa Temuujin. Their work appears in journals such as Health & Social Care in the Community, Journal of Health Organization and Management, Journal of Health Services Research & Policy, Social Science & Medicine and Health Policy.
